Mills’ sharp pitching performance fuels 51s’ victory

Left-hander Brad Mills took a perfect game into the sixth inning to help the 51s defeat the Portland Beavers 10-1 Tuesday in a Pacific Coast League game in Portland, Ore.

Mills (5-4), who walked none and struck out six, gave up a leadoff single in the sixth to Lance Zawadski, who advanced to second on an error by left fielder Aaron Mathews.

Mills struck out the next two batters before Luis Durango singled home Zawadski. Mills induced a ground ball for the third out and left with a 4-1 lead.

51s relievers Bubbie Buzachero and Lance Broadway finished the six-hitter.

Las Vegas (40-46) broke open the game with a six-run seventh, highlighted by Raul Chavez's two-run double.

J.P. Arencibia, Mathews and Chavez each had two hits and two RBIs for the 51s.

Arencibia's 22nd home run, a two-run shot in the third, gave Las Vegas a 2-0 lead.
